A Proposed Method for Contour Extraction of an Image Based On Self-Affine Mapping System by Fractal CodingKeywords: Contour Extraction , Fractals coding , Self-Affine Snake , Image segmentation , LIFS Abstract: A self-affine mapping system instead of the energy minimization procedure is used to approach and fit the roughly drawn line to the object contour. The self-affine map’s parameters are detected by analyzing the block wise self-similarity of a gray-scale image using an algorithm in fractal encoding techniques. The edges are attracting mapping points in self-affine mapping is utilized in the proposed method. The proposed method accurately produces smooth curves sharp corners and to extract both distinct edges and blurred edges. The large gaps between the hand-draw line and the contour can be fitted well by our proposed method and algorithms. In this method block size is progressively decreased. These procedures reduce the time required for drawing contours by hands. As a result, highly accurate contours were extracted in our proposed method.
